Advancing decarbonisation: The critical role of gas monitoring systems

Being able to effectively detect gases is a vital part of the health and safety operations of organisations in the industrial sector. A recent survey by Health and Safety International and Riken Keiki, a Japanese company that specialises in gas detection, finds 59% of health and safety professionals believe this is a ‘very important’ part of their job, with a further 30% rating it as ‘important’. 

While some organisations may only require single-component gas detection, in many applications multi-gas detection is required. Two-thirds of respondents (67%) say multi-gas detection is ‘very important’, and another quarter (25%) say this is ‘important’, in their roles.
